Daniel Elfadli has recently been linked several times with a departure from HSV. Now, however, the defensive all-rounder has apparently made an initial decision. And it points to him staying at the Volkspark.

Just a few weeks ago, a departure for the 29-year-old seemed entirely possible. Elfadli endured a difficult first Bundesliga season and was anything but happy with his role. While he had still been one of the team’s most important performers during the promotion campaign, he found himself on the bench more and more often in the top flight.

Now, however, Mopo reports that the German-Libyan wants to take a different path. Instead of pushing for a quick move, Elfadli wants to use pre-season to prove himself at HSV. With performance testing beginning in early July, this marks a fresh start for him.

The sporting developments of recent months are likely to have caused plenty of frustration. In 15 of his 21 league appearances, Elfadli only came on as a substitute. The end of the season was especially bitter: across the last five matches, he played a total of just eleven minutes.

Elfadli wants to earn a stay at HSV

Expectations had been high after promotion. Sporting director Claus Costa even believed Elfadli had the potential to take the next step in his career. However, injuries, a suspension, shaky performances such as the one against VfL Wolfsburg, and strong competition in Hamburg’s defense led to him losing his regular place.

Even so, the veteran wants to stay — although much will certainly depend on what role coach Merlin Polzin sees for him going forward. The situation at center-back in particular could still change in the coming weeks. Following the end of Luka Vuskovic’s loan spell, there is an urgent need for action there.

Elfadli wants to monitor the situation closely and force his way into contention in training. But if it still becomes clear that his playing time will remain limited, he could push for a transfer later in the summer.
